About Lam Research

Lam Research Corporation (Lam Research) is a supplier of wafer fabrication equipment and services to the worldwide semiconductor industry. Lam Research designs, manufactures, markets, refurbish, and services semiconductor processing equipment used in the fabrication of integrated circuits. The Company’s etch and clean technologies enable customers to build integrated circuits. Its etch systems shape the microscopic conductive and dielectric layers into circuits that define a chip’s final use and function. Its Customer Support Business Group (CSBG) provides products and services to maximize installed equipment performance and operational efficiency. Its customer base includes semiconductor memory, foundry, and integrated device manufacturers (IDMs) that make DRAM, NAND, and logic devices for these products.
